COOKING HOB CONTROL KNOB
These knobs provide control of the ceramic hob's cooking zones.
The zone it controls is shown above each knob. The knob shown on the right is
for the front left-hand cooking zone.
Turn the knob to the right to set the zone's operating power; the settings range
from a minimum of 1 to a maximum of 9.
The working power is shown by a display on the hob.
Heating accelerator
Each cooking zone is equipped with a heating accelerator.
This system allows the zone to be operated at peak power for a time proportional to the heating
power selected.
To start the heating accelerator, turn the knob to the left, select setting “A” and then release. The
letter “A” will appear on the display on the hob.
You now have 3 seconds to select the heating setting of your choice.
Once a setting between 1 and 8 has been selected, “A” and the chosen setting will flash in alternation
on the display.
While the heating accelerator is in operation, the heating level can be increased at any time. The "full
power" time will be modified accordingly.
Conversely, the heating level cannot be reduced. If the knob is turned to the right while the heating
accelerator is in operation, this will stop it immediately.
